Abstract
BALLESTEROS-RICAURTE, Javier-Antonio; AVENDANO-FERNANDEZ, Eduardo; GONZALEZ-AMARILLO, Angela-María and GRANADOS-COMBA, Adriana. Scientific Mapping in the Search for Information. Case Study: Infectious Diseases in Bovines. Rev. Cient. [online]. 2021, n.42, pp.265-275. Epub Oct 18, 2021. ISSN 0124-2253. https://doi.org/10.14483/23448350.17532.
The steps to be followed in a scientific mapping process on a research topic are proposed using tools that allow identifying different relationships and performing analyses between articles, taking the topic of infectious bovine diseases as a case study. The employed methodology is based on six steps that go from information retrieval through systematic literature review to the visualization of the results by means of the SciMAT scientific map analysis tool, mainly using the keywords, the H index, and the occurrence of the terms in the text. As a result, it is found that studies on infectious bovine diseases have focused on subtopics such as disease outbreaks, the treatments used, prevention models, and analysis of laboratory samples. On the other hand, it is indicated that further studies are needed on the use of computer tools or the development of applications that use modern techniques such as artificial intelligence and machine learning to support the analysis, control, and eradication of infectious bovine diseases.
